Can you describe how Techs work with and mentor younger techs?

We have an in house mentorship program for our incoming C-Tech's/apprentices. They have a set amount of skills to master in a minimum of one year in additional to the on-line module requirements set by the manufacturer. Once a C-tech has completed all self studies in a particular area, they are paired with a Master Tech to be their personal mentor. Their Master-Tech is tasked with guiding them through everything from basic disassembly/replacement to diagnostic paths and theory.

A Level Technician
A Level Technicians are highly skilled technicians that have strengths in their diagnostic and mechanical ability. This level of technician typically has many years of experience and education. We view an A Level Technician as the highest skilled technician in a shop
Pay Range: $56,000 - $90,000/year

All tech pay plans have a weekly production bonus included.

B Level Technician
B Level Technicians are skilled in mechanical repair and, while not their specialty, have some diagnostic skills. B Level Technicians generally have a fair amount of experience and can be trusted to handle most repairs.
Pay Range: $45,000 - $65,000/year

All tech pay plans have a weekly production bonus included.

C Level Technician
C Level Technicians are more of entry level technicians. C Level Technicians’ responsibilities typically include basic maintenance, alignments, brake and suspension work, along with other base level repairs.
Pay Range: $34,000 - $65,000/year

All tech pay plans have a weekly production bonus included.

Health Insurance Offered
UnitedHealthcare is our current medical healthcare administrator. Medical Plan - United HealthCare (UHC) • Eligibility: The Sunday following 84 days of employment • 2 Plans to choose from • Weekly Premiums based on how many individuals covered on the plan and Income
Dental Insurance Offered
Through Cigna Healthcare employees have a choice of two PPO Dental options • Eligibility: The Sunday following 84 days of employment.
Vision Insurance Offered
UnitedHealthcare is our current vision administrator. • Eligibility: The Sunday following 84 days of employment.
Retirement Plan Offered
401 K Company match offered through Fidelity. All full-time and part-time team members are eligible to participate in the retirement savings plan. • Eligibility: The Sunday following 84 days of employment. • Company match after one year of 50% on the first 6% of deferral. • Three year vesting scheduling on company match
Sick Leave Not Offered
Vacation Offered
PTO offered. (Up to 22 days depending on length of employment service) PTO (Paid Time Off) • Available to use after 6 months of employment. • PTO hours will be awarded based on tenure and date of hire as of January 1. • For new hires hired in: o January-88 hours (11 days) o February-80 hours (10 days) o March-72 hours (9 days) o April-64 hours (8 days) o May-56 hours (7 days) • 6 months to 2 years tenure on January 1-88 hours per calendar year. • 3 to 6 years tenure on January 1-136 hours per calendar year • 7+ years tenure on January 1-176 hours per calendar year.
Paid Holidays Offered
Technicians and Fixed Operations Employees receive 6 paid holidays. These holidays include: New Years Day, Memorial Day, Fourth of July, Labor Day, Thanksgiving, and Christmas Day.
ST / LT Disability Offered
Short term disability and long term disability insurance offered.
Life Insurance Offered
Company-paid life insurance • $30,000 Company paid life insurance provided to all full time team members. • Additional life insurance may be purchased on team member, spouse and/or children
Uniforms Offered
Technician uniforms provided by employer
Other Offered
• Tool allowances available for select positions. Holiday Match Program- Team members who elect to defer one percent (1%) of their earnings up to a maximum of $100,000 gross wages (maximum $1,000 deferral) will receive that back on or after Thanksgiving plus another one percent (1%) match from the company (maximum $1,000 match from the company). Paid Pregnancy Disability Leave - Unum • Eligible after completing one year of continuous employment. • Paid leave up to eight weeks with 100% salary replacement Paid Paternity Leave • Eligible after completing one year of continuous employment • Paid leave for one week following the birth of a child.
